Two forces whose magnitudes are in the ratio `3:5` give a resultant of 28N. If the angle of their inclination is `60^@`, find the magnitude of each force. |
Answer» Let `F_(1)` and `F_(2)` be the two forces. Then `F_(1)=3x,F_(2)=5x,R=28N` and `theta=60^(@)` `R=sqrt(F_(1)^(2)+F_(2)^(2)+2F_(1)F_(2)cos theta` ` rArr 28=sqrt((3x)+(5x)^(2)+2(3x)(5x)cos 60^(@)` `rArr 28=sqrt(9x^(2)+25x^(2)+15x^(2))=7x` `rArr x=28/7=4` `:. F_(1)=3xx4=12N,F_(2)=5xx4=20N`. |
